Description
RayBright® Live UV450 is an amine-reactive fluorescent dye that binds both live and dead cells, with a much brighter signal in dead cells than living cells which refuse the dye while dead cells are stained both on the cell surface and intracellularly. This dye can be used to discriminate live and dead cells in flow cytometry analysis and is supplied frozen in DMSO solution at a pre-titrated concentration. End users are recommended to further determine the optimal concentration for their specific cell types.
